The Washington Post Supports Southwick Nomination
In Saturday's lead editorial, the Washington Post expressed support for Judge Southwick's nomination.
[W]e cannot find fault with Judge Southwick's narrow but ultimately legitimate interpretation of the law...and we do not find in his record the anti-gay, anti-worker caricature his opponents have drawn. Sen. Dianne Feinstein, Calif., the lone Democrat on the Senate Judiciary Committee to vote in favor of his confirmation, got it right when she concluded that if senators were to examine Judge Southwick's entire career, including his stint as a judge advocate in Iraq, they would find a "qualified, circumspect person."
